Chelsea had their first major success in 1955, when they won the league championship. The club's greatest period of success has come during the last two decades; winning 17 major trophies, and 21 in total, since 1997. The club's regular kit colours are royal blue shirts and shorts with white socks. It's crest has been changed several times in attempts to re-brand the club and modernise its image. The current crest, featuring a ceremonial lion rampant regardant holding a staff, is a modification of the one introduced in the early 1950s. The club have the 6th highest average all-time attendance in English football. Their average home gate for the 2015-16 season was 41,500, the 7th highest in the Premier League. In 2016, CFC was ranked by Forbes magazine as the 7th most valuable football club in the world, at 1.15 billion pound($1.66 billion).
